[0023] Below in conjunction with all accompanying drawings the present invention will be further described, and preferred embodiment of the present invention is: see appended figure 1 , the melt processing device in the hypereutectic aluminum-silicon alloy continuous casting process described in this embodiment includes an air duct 1, a powder spraying device 2, a duct 3, an electromagnetic stirrer 4, a crystallizer 5, and an ingot 6 , modificator 7, slit passage 8, powder injection hole 9, alloy melt 10, hot top 11, wherein, the material of powder injection device 2 is aluminum silicate insulation material, the outer wall is smooth, and the outer wall diameter is 40mm. The inner diameter of the draft tube 3 is 60 mm, and the inner diameter of the graphite ring in the crystallizer 5 is 75 mm. The top of the powder spraying device 2 communicates with the air duct 1.
